One noticeable aspect of PCB manufacturing is the increasing interest in flexible PCBs.  Flexible PCB  Manufacturer , or flex circuits, are made from slim, flexible materials that permit flexing, twisting, and folding to accommodate unique shapes and designs. They are specifically valuable in portable tools where area is restricted, such as smart devices, wearables, and medical devices. The ability to fit PCB layouts into non-traditional areas while keeping capability is a game-changer in item style. Flexible PCB producers are furnished with specialized innovations that allow accurate manufacturing procedures, guaranteeing these boards perform ideally under different problems. As markets remain to change in the direction of smaller, more versatile electronic devices, flexible PCBs are ending up being a vital element in product technology, allowing designers to assume outside the box in their creations.

In contrast to flexible PCBs, rigid-flex PCBs offer an one-of-a-kind combination of both flexible and rigid aspects. Rigid-flex PCBs are usually used in applications where room is at a premium, such as in aerospace, automotive, and medical tools. Picking a dependable rigid-flex PCB manufacturer guarantees that the boards are built to the highest possible criteria, which is essential for performance-critical applications where failure is not a choice.

Ceramic PCBs are an additional noteworthy development in PCB innovation, known for their superior thermal conductivity, mechanical stamina, and electrical insulation residential properties. Manufacturers specializing in ceramic PCB manufacturing utilize sophisticated methods and products to ensure the optimum performance of these boards, highlighting the significance of partnering with professionals that recognize the subtleties of ceramic materials.

Applications in telecoms, radar systems, and microwave tools count heavily on high-frequency PCBs to make certain dependable performance. Suppliers of high-frequency PCBs require specific understanding and advanced testing capacities to make certain that the materials utilized can do effectively under the pressures of high-frequency applications. By focusing on employing materials such as PTFE and various other low-loss dielectrics, along with precise construction procedures, these suppliers can create PCBs that fulfill the strict demands of contemporary electronic applications.

Quality control is another considerable factor that ought to never be neglected throughout the PCB production and assembly processes. Strenuous quality assurance procedures must be developed to ensure that every board meets the defined requirements prior to being delivered to customers. Applying quality checks at various stages-- from basic material evaluation to final assembly examinations-- makes certain that prospective problems are determined early in the procedure, lessening the risk of failings in the field. Reputable suppliers usually stick to global criteria such as ISO 9001, which assures a systemic strategy to high quality monitoring.
